This presentation by Susan Fawcett of the Down Syndrome Resource Foundation was delivered at the Canadian Down Syndrome Pre-Conference for Educators, May 10, 2019 in Victoria, BC.

Discover what we currently know about the overall characteristics and learning style of people who have Down syndrome, and how we can apply this knowledge when working with these students. The impact of health factors, behavioural profiles, cognitive development, and physical and sensory needs are discussed.

Presenter – Susan Fawcett, M.Sc. RSLP, PhD Candidate: Susan has been a Speech-Language Pathologist at the Down Syndrome Resource Foundation for 15 years. She is in the final stages of her PhD program at the University of British Columbia, where she is studying Family-Centered Positive Behaviour Support under Dr. Joe Lucyshyn. Her dissertation project involves examining the impact of a parent training program on the behaviour of children with Down syndrome, as well as parent stress levels.
